CREATING AND EDITING WAVEFORMS
Create waveforms by loading waveform data from a text file or by using the graphical tools of this
Software.
Working with text files
Waveforms can be imported to or exported from a text file with the following format:
The first line contains the number of data points, the consecutive lines the Y axis value of the
sampling points.
Example wave1.txt:
8 (Line 1length of the waveform)
-0.666 (Line 2waveform value of point 0)
-0.555 (Line 3waveform value of point 1)
-0.111 (Line 4waveform value of point 2)
0.001 (Line 5waveform value of point 3)
0.123 (Line 6waveform value of point 4)
0.235 (Line 7waveform value of point 5)
0.378 (Line 8waveform value of point 6)
0.654 (Line 9waveform value of point 7)
Only use text editors such as NOTEPAD to create or edit this file.
Saving and opening text files
To save the current waveform as a text file, Select File>Save to and enter a filename. To import
waveform data, select “Open” from the File menu. The waveform data will be automatically
displayed in the editing window.
